What´s a natural disaster?
(Answers may vary)
It´s a natural event such as a flood, earthquake, or hurricane that causes great damage or loss of life.

What´s the difference between:
A tsunami and an avalanche?
A drought and flood?
A tsunami is an extremely large wave caused by a violent movement of the earth under the sea.
An avalanche is a mass of snow, ice, and rocks falling rapidly down a mountainside.
A drought is a prolonged period of abnormally low rainfall, leading to a shortage of water.
A flood is a large amount of water beyond its normal limits, especially over what is normally dry land.
